A very skilled and famous skyscraper climber falls off the Empire State Building while attempting to scale it. Mac Taylor and Sheldon Hawkes (on his first field assignment) investigate the case. In another part of the city, Stella Bonasera and Danny Messer must solve the mysterious death of a famous designer found dead, wearing his latest creation which is a bra made of diamonds. Aiden Burn works solo on a rape case.

A plastic surgeon is found dead at Grand Central Station during rush hour. He apparently died from inhaling lye. Stella and Danny investigate the death of a blind woman. Aiden is more intent than ever to solve the rape case; so much so that she does the unthinkable, an action which forces Mac to fire her.

A young girl lands on the windshield of the car. Her feet tell Stella that she was a dancer. Lindsay Monroe works solo on the death of an old tram driver. She soon realizes that her case is related to the first. The third case involves the death of a fish merchant. He died from a fatal wound caused by a swordfish.

A young woman gets on an elevator with an older man. When the door opens on his penthouse, he is shot by an unseen person. The girl is not hurt and the team must track her down as she is the only eye-witness to the murder. Stella and Sheldon Hawkes fish a body out of a pond in Central Park. The man, however, did not die from drowning. He suffered a fatal allergic reaction.

Four men are playing poker in an apartment. When they catch a man cheating, the other men throw him out. Just a few moments later, the doorbell rings; when one of the players looks through the peephole, expecting to see the recently departed cheater, he is facing the barrel of a shotgun and is instantly killed. Meanwhile, in Central Park, a TV weather girl is found dead on the ground. Autopsy reveals that she drowned, even though there is no water near the crime scene.

A teenage boy stumbles upon a dead body in a shop full of dolls. The man was the owner of the doll hospital. The room shows signs of a great struggle with dolls scattered all over the floor. In an upscale apartment, Stella and Sheldon Hawkes examine the body of a waitress who had cancer. As opposed to the other crime scene, this room is in perfect order except for a spilled can of soup.

Danny and Stella are investigating the murder of a billionaire in a crime scene that seems to be a bedroom, but while Stella is interrogating suspects, Danny searches the room for possible evidence and accidentally pushes a button that turns the bedroom into a panic room. With Danny trapped inside, they have to find a way to get him out while a murderer is at large. Meanwhile, the body is decomposing from the heat which forces Danny to use old-school processing techniques.
